NoScript for FF57 buggy
Posted: Tue Nov 21, 2017 11:04 am
Hi,
thanks for updating NoScript for FF 57; I felt completely naked browsing without it.
However, it is currently too buggy to be useful. I remember being able to click on the buttons (trusted--not trusted--default), but then that only opened down a panel and only the lock icon worked. Also, the even though pressing on the lock icon seemed to work, the next time I opened the dropdown, sites I am sure enabled JS for were red again and some sites I did not became green. So I guess the list indexing thing was messed up, but I cannot be sure if only for the display.
Another issue with UI is that it is completely unintuitive; especially the long list does not help (why do we have a long list that's full of red locks? Shouldn't NS just maintain a whitelist?)
Also, it somehow messed GitHub + Jupyter up completely, so I had to disable it.
